  • Iron ore beneficiation: an overview ScienceDirect

    2.4. Beneficiation methods. Beneficiation is a process where ore is reduced in size and valuable minerals are separated from the gangue minerals. Separation of valuable minerals from gangue minerals can be efficiently achieved by taking advantage of the differences in physical, surface, and magnetic properties.

  • Iron Ore Beneficiation Multotec

    Overview of a typical Iron Ore Process flow sheet: Primary stages of iron ore beneficiation, essentially, result in three iron ore product types, namely Coarse, Medium and Fine. Coarse Product. From the ROM stockpile ore is crushed and screened using gyratory crushers, grizzly screens and cone crushers before being sized through a sizing screen.

  • Dry beneficiation of iron ore Mineral Processing

    The haematite ore in South Africa is processed in a dry process to a HQ lump ore with 64 % iron content and a sintered fine ore with 63.5 % iron content. For fine ore beneficiation, wet processes are used. Capacity at the Minas Rio is to be increased from 26.5 Mta capacity to 28 Mta in the forthcoming years.

  • What is iron ore beneficiation? Shandong Jiugang Tisco

    Iron ore is an important raw material for steel production enterprises. In most cases, iron ore with a grade of less than 50% requires ore beneficiation before smelting and utilization. Natural ore (iron ore) is gradually selected for iron through procedures such as crushing, grinding, magnetic separation, flotation, and gravity separation.

  • Iron Ore Tailing Beneficiation a Potential Resource for

    Tailing beneficiation of iron ore has been addressed either by flotation or wet high intensity high gradient separation. The present study aims to recover iron values from discarded slime containing assay ~56% Fe, ~6.5% SiO2, and ~7.0% Al2O3 from Noamundi processing plant by using high gradient magnetic separator (HGMS).
